After formatting windows, I started to have problems with sounds. Both sound and music don't start when the game on voobly starts (but they work totally fine when I open the game on steam).

The only way they work on voobly is when I press F6 (music start) and go out in the middle of the game (to windows) and come back to the game (sounds start).

The volumes are at the highest when I enter on single player on voobly.

I have reinstalled all (stem, ageHD and voobly) twice, following the links the support team gave me.

Also I have done what this website says ([You must login to view link]).

A friend told me to check if I have the drivers but I followed his instructions and in all occasions it says that I have already had all the drivers updated.

What can I do? The voobly team told me to write this here...

I think I might have discovered something! I have an ASUS laptop connected to an HP monitor, in the adapter (monitor-VGA to notebook-HDMI) there is also an input to connection the external speakers (which I use). I tried disconnecting the monitor and speakers and trying a single player match on voobly just with the laptop itself and the sounds works well! .

It's really strange though. I played a game with other voobly players (though it was not wololo) and I had sound from the beginning...

Now I am experimenting and there are strange patterns that I think are related to the adapter: for instance, I started an Allied vision game (without putting single player) just on my own with a machine and I had sound from the beginning. Then, using the same mod, I did the same but with single player menu and I had no sound anymore.

Also as I disconnected the monitor to try, I started a game with wololo (and the resolution was default in 800 I think) and I also had sound from the beginning. Then I changed the resolution to the recommended for the HP added monitor (1366x...) but I had no sound anymore...

I don't know what to do, I also tried connecting the external speakers directly to the notebook but I still have problems using that option...

Maybe the previous may help in some way.

I have bought a new screen (which does not need VGA-HDMI adapter) and the sound problem finished...so, it seems it was a problem of the adapter.
